Sports Medicine Services at UH Ahuja Medical Center

The sports medicine program at UH Ahuja Medical Center is proud to offer the highest quality care for athletes of all ages and every skill level – from children as young as toddlers to active seniors who participate in sports activities well into their 90s.

Our orthopedic and sports medicine experts collaborate to offer a proactive approach to sports injury prevention through education and sports performance programs for athletes. When sports injuries occur, our team provides the most advanced diagnostics, surgical and nonsurgical treatment options, and comprehensive rehabilitation services.

UH Drusinsky Sports Medicine Institute

Our multi-purpose sports complex sets a new standard for modern orthopedic care – providing every athlete with access to the comprehensive, multidisciplinary care they need to perform at the top of their game.

This world-class facility is staffed by board-certified orthopedic surgeons and leaders in sports medicine, providing a home for athletes of all ages and abilities. Our goal is to offer a seamless treatment journey from consult and diagnosis to surgery, with continued care through rehabilitation, performance assessments and performance training – all in one location.

Patients also have convenient access to other specialty care including sports cardiology, concussion and neurological care, nutrition services and postoperative pain management alternatives.


Offering a Unique Model of Care

Patients with sports injuries or those recovering from joint replacement procedures are not ill and require a different kind of care. To meet the needs of these patients, many orthopedic and sports medicine services are now performed on an outpatient basis. The experts at the UH Drusinsky Sports Medicine Institute employ this outpatient model of care whenever possible, using cutting-edge technology such as robot-assisted surgery to lower the risk of complications and reduce recovery time. Patients are then able to transition more quickly to the rehabilitation/recovery process and return to their active lifestyle.


Facility Features and Amenities

Our new 78,000 square foot, multi-story complex is the premier community destination for the highest quality orthopedic and sports medicine care, offered in a friendly, patient-centered setting. Services at the facility include the following specialty amenities and features::

  • Performance Training by T3 Performance. Sports performance training classes for adults and young athletes. Speed, strength and skill training options are available.

  • Orthopedic Injury Clinic. Our orthopedic injury clinic offers dedicated imaging and diagnostic services for orthopedic and sports-related emergencies. Walk-ins are welcome and appointments are not necessary.

  • On-Site Surgical Services. A dedicated surgical center, ensuring seamless and timely access to a full spectrum of orthopedic surgeries and procedures.

  • Sports Rehabilitation. The Sports Performance Center offers a variety of turfs and playing surfaces, a therapy pool, state-of-the-art training equipment and more to help athletes recover from sports injuries and achieve their athletic goals.

  • Conditioning and Performance Assessments. Expert recommendations and assessments help keep the body strong, measure progress and minimize the risk of future injury.
  • Personalized Support. The complex will offer supportive services such as pre-operative classes to educate and prepare patients; patient navigators to reduce anxiety and guide patients throughout their care journey; and comprehensive rehabilitation plans to speed recovery.
  • Café. An onsite café offering healthy snacks, meals and beverages to support your fitness goals.
